Output ffe22682394ffcad0cf2d990a84e95257ce1c9f751291968af626ff9ce8d0a47:7

value
27503969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6086baad9259d1264de4f1952df627f69cd46352 OP_EQUAL
address
MGhYVzhTBrCFhw9QrXH86VyxLQoTrWsrw2
transaction
ffe22682394ffcad0cf2d990a84e95257ce1c9f751291968af626ff9ce8d0a47
spent
true